A 38-year-old black man had developed sarcoidosis, confirmed by biopsy five years earlier. He then developed skin lesions and, at age 38, follicles and cicatrization of the upper and lower palpebral conjunctivae of both eyes. This patient had keratoconjunctivitis sicca, lacrimal gland enlargement, and cicatrization of the conjunctiva with symblepharon. Biopsies of the lacrimal gland, conjunctiva, skin, nasal polyps, and epididymis all showed sarcoidosis.
